Purchased cheap video game on iPad for grandchildren with Capital One MC — $2.50 charged by HCTCSupport.com. A few days later another charge appeared on same MC account for $39.95. Called number; waited for more than 5 minutes listening to horrible music; no answer. Called several times over next week or so; sometimes got busy signal (that's what happened when Capital One fraud personnell called). Then Capital One refused to honor their so-called fraud insurance because I couldn't prove that I didn't authorize the charge.
I suspect that the game offered my grandson the opportunity to buy something else (an upgrade or extra "bullets" for the game or whatever — we saw a few such requests while he was playing; told him to always say "no" or "cancel", but maybe he blew it once. He is only 7; but we never authorized any additional payment).
